Item 2.05.  Costs Associated with Exit or Disposal Activities

On June 26, 2014, ANADIGICS, Inc. (the “Company”) announced a restructuring plan to lower its operating costs and better align resources to address growth opportunities in rapidly expanding infrastructure markets.  The plan includes expanding the Company’s presence in the infrastructure space and reducing the fixed costs associated with the legacy mobile business through a resizing of the Company’s staff and manufacturing capability.  The plan is currently anticipated to be complete by the end of 2014.

In connection with the plan, a workforce reduction will eliminate approximately 140 positions throughout the Company or approximately 30%.  The Company expects to record a restructuring charge totaling approximately $7.3 million, comprised of a cash workforce restructuring charge of approximately $2.3 million and a non-cash charge of approximately $5.0 million for fixed asset and inventory write downs.  The restructuring charge is expected to be expensed in the second and third quarters of 2014.  The Company expects approximately $2.3 million of the total charge to be in the form of cash expenditures, substantially all of which is expected to be paid out in the third quarter of 2014.  The Company expects the changes, when completed, to result in annualized operating cost savings of approximately $15.0 million, comprised of approximately $5.0 million through a decrease of manufacturing costs and approximately $10.0 million through a decrease in operating costs.
